Nero Budur is a professor at KU Leuven in the Department of Mathematics. His research focuses on various aspects of algebraic geometry, including topology and singularity theory. Budur has led significant research projects that delve into D-modules, combinatorial properties, and the theory surrounding arcs and jets in algebraic structures. He has presented his findings at several renowned academic conferences, such as the Jean Morlet Semester, CIRM, and has been involved in collaborative works that explore the relationship between deformation theory and cohomological constraints. Budur has authored numerous publications, some of which have appeared in high-impact journals in mathematics, and he actively engages in teaching and mentoring students in advanced mathematical concepts.
